Herod Linsay, Davis County, Texas, 1867

Herod Linsay registered to vote in Davis County on July 13, 1867. He reported North Carolina as his birthplace and 8 years in Texas, 7 of them in Davis County. The registrar wrote "Colored" beside his name. Davis County registered 986 freedmen in 1867, 35% of its voters.
